What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to making use of two panes of glass in a window unit, separated by an air or gas-filled area. This creates an effective thermal barrier, decreasing heat transfer and adding to lower energy bills. The gaps between the panes can be filled with inert gases such as argon or krypton, even more improving insulation.

Setting up double glazing is a task that can either be carried out by expert installers or DIY lovers with the ideal abilities. The list below steps lay out the setup procedure:
1. PreparationMeasure the Windows: Accurate measurements of existing windows are essential for ordering the appropriate size of double-glazed systems.Pick a Style: Decide on window designs, such as casement, sash, or tilt-and-turn.2. Purchasing the Double Glazed Units
As soon as the measurements are taken, it is time to order the double-glazed units. Make certain to choose the type of glass, frame product, and any extra features, such as gas filling or low-E finishes.
3. Elimination of Old WindowsThoroughly remove the existing window systems by loosening frames and taking them out, ensuring very little damage to the surrounding locations.4. Setting Up the New Double Glazed UnitsLocation the Frame: Insert the brand-new double-glazed frame into the opening and look for level and plumb.Seal the Unit: Apply sealant around the frames to make sure an airtight fit, further enhancing insulation.Secure the Frame: Fix the frame in location using screws or brackets, ensuring it's safe.Ending up Touches: Install trims and surfaces to complete the appearance, guaranteeing all gaps are sealed.5. Evaluating
Finally, test the operation of any movable parts, guarantee they open and close efficiently, and look for any drafts or leaks.
6. Tidying up
Dispose of the old window systems and clean the work area. As soon as done, the new setup should be ready for use.
